为什么我的机器没有均匀使用所有虚拟CPU?

huangapple go评论49阅读模式
英文:

Why my machine isn't using equaly the all vCPUs?

问题

我正在使用AWS EC2上的Sentry on-premise,运行在一个Docker容器中的m5.large实例上,但我面临一个问题:我的2个虚拟CPU并没有均匀使用。其中一个使用率达到了100%,而另一个不到5%。为什么会出现这种情况?

英文:

I am working with Sentry on-premise in one AWS EC2 m5.large instance in Docker but I am in front of a problem: My 2vCPUs aren't using equaly. One of them was with 100% and the other with less than 5%. Why this happen?

Print of the htop command

答案1

得分: 0

这显然是由一个名为kdevtmpfsi的恶意软件引起的,它是一个挖矿程序。
我正在尝试清除这个机器并创建一个VPN。

英文:

apparently, this was caused by a malware called kdevtmpfsi, a miner.
I am trying to remove this cleaning the machine and creating a VPN

答案2

得分: 0

我们在使用 Docker 运行 Apache Flink 时遇到了相同的问题,
当我们移除了端口映射(8081)后,问题得以解决,看起来这个恶意软件利用已知端口(如 redis、flink 等)进行远程代码执行。
请检查您的端口映射和防火墙。
也许可以尝试映射到一个不太常用的端口号,或者将您的 Docker 实例放在一个 Nginx 实例后面,并进行前缀路由。
希望这有所帮助。

英文:

We had the same problem with running Apache Flink in docker,
when we removed the port mapping (8081) it was solved, looks like this malware exploits known ports (e.g redis,flink and others) for remote code execution.
check your port mapping and firewall.
maybe try to map to a not so popular port number of put your docker instance behind an nginx instance and do prefix routing.
Hope this helps.

huangapple
  • 本文由 发表于 2020年1月4日 00:12:12
  • 转载请务必保留本文链接:https://go.coder-hub.com/59581775.html
匿名

发表评论

匿名网友

: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en:

确定